Ras Al Kahimah vs Akita Climate & Distance Between

Japan flag
  • The distance between Ras Al Kahimah, United Arab Emirates and Akita, Japan is approximately 7,751 km or 4,817 mi.
  • To reach Ras Al Kahimah in this distance one would set out from Akita bearing 287°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Ras Al Kahimah bearing 234.7° or SW .
  • Ras Al Kahimah has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h) whereas Akita has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• The average temperature is 16.1 °C (29°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 7.6 °C (13.7°F) less in Ras Al Kahimah.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1613.6 mm (63.5 in) less which is equivalent to 1613.6 l/m² (39.6 US gal/ft²) or 16,136,000 l/ha (1,725,045 US gal/ac) less. About 0 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 14° higher in Ras Al Kahimah than in Akita.
  • Relative humidity levels are 16.3%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 11.2°C (20.1°F) higher.
